Count ME: A Milestone For ME/CFS Recognition In Australia
In a groundbreaking development for the myalgic encephalomyelitis/chronic fatigue syndrome (ME/CFS) community, ME/CFS will be included in the upcoming Australian Burden of Disease Study (ABDS), set to be released by the Australian Institute of Health and Welfare (AIHW) in December 2026.

ME/CFS Australia is a peak body for patient-led ME/CFS charities across Australia. Our focus is on advocacy with the federal government; research initiatives; national collaboration between organisations; and awareness campaigns.
We aim to improve access and inclusion for people with ME/CFS in health care, disability services, welfare, and other national services.
We do not offer member services to individuals as this is provided by local organisations. Find our local organisations.
